Astral Sorcery

Astral Sorcery

63M Downloads

cannot pour out starlight manually

ZZZank opened this issue · 0 comments

commented

discribe the issue

when REI is installed, a player cannot pour a bucket of starlight mannually, but it can be poured out through dispenser.
the problem still occured when there are only rei and astralsorcery in the mod list.
but the problem disappered when i replace rei with jei.

relevant log

i think only these are related, other logs didn't even mentioned rei or AS.

[3011月2022 21:02:37.147] [REI-ReloadPlugins/ERROR] [REI/]: JEI Plugin [IntegrationJEI:astralsorcery:jei_integration] [astralsorcery] plugin failed to reloadable-plugin/TransferHandlerRegistryImpl/!
java.lang.NoClassDefFoundError: mezz/jei/network/packets/PacketJei
	at hellfirepvp.astralsorcery.common.integration.IntegrationJEI.registerRecipeTransferHandlers(IntegrationJEI.java:128) ~[astralsorcery:1.16.4-1.14.1]
	at me.shedaniel.rei.jeicompat.JEIPluginDetector$JEIPluginWrapper.registerTransferHandlers(JEIPluginDetector.java:511) ~[roughlyenoughitems:?]
	at me.shedaniel.rei.impl.client.transfer.TransferHandlerRegistryImpl.acceptPlugin(TransferHandlerRegistryImpl.java:43) ~[roughlyenoughitems:?]
	at me.shedaniel.rei.impl.client.transfer.TransferHandlerRegistryImpl.acceptPlugin(TransferHandlerRegistryImpl.java:37) ~[roughlyenoughitems:?]
	at me.shedaniel.rei.api.common.registry.Reloadable.acceptPlugin(Reloadable.java:72) ~[roughlyenoughitems:?]
	at me.shedaniel.rei.impl.common.plugins.PluginManagerImpl.lambda$startReload$8(PluginManagerImpl.java:300) ~[roughlyenoughitems:?]
	at me.shedaniel.rei.impl.common.plugins.PluginManagerImpl.pluginSection(PluginManagerImpl.java:180) ~[roughlyenoughitems:?]
	at me.shedaniel.rei.impl.common.plugins.PluginManagerImpl.startReload(PluginManagerImpl.java:289) ~[roughlyenoughitems:?]
	at me.shedaniel.rei.RoughlyEnoughItemsCore._reloadPlugins(RoughlyEnoughItemsCore.java:141) ~[roughlyenoughitems:?]
	at me.shedaniel.rei.RoughlyEnoughItemsCore._reloadPlugins(RoughlyEnoughItemsCore.java:132) ~[roughlyenoughitems:?]
	at me.shedaniel.rei.RoughlyEnoughItemsCoreClient.lambda$reloadPlugins$22(RoughlyEnoughItemsCoreClient.java:436) ~[roughlyenoughitems:?]
	at java.util.concurrent.CompletableFuture$AsyncRun.run(CompletableFuture.java:1800) [?:?]
	at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:515) [?:?]
	at java.util.concurrent.FutureTask.run(FutureTask.java:264) [?:?]
	at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:304) [?:?]
	at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1130) [?:?]
	at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:630) [?:?]
	at java.lang.Thread.run(Thread.java:831) [?:?]
Caused by: java.lang.ClassNotFoundException: mezz.jei.network.packets.PacketJei
	at java.lang.ClassLoader.findClass(ClassLoader.java:716) ~[?:?]
	at java.lang.ClassLoader.loadClass(ClassLoader.java:586) ~[?:?]
	at cpw.mods.modlauncher.TransformingClassLoader.loadClass(TransformingClassLoader.java:106) ~[modlauncher-8.1.3.jar:?]
	at java.lang.ClassLoader.loadClass(ClassLoader.java:519) ~[?:?]
	... 18 more
	Suppressed: java.lang.ClassNotFoundException
		at cpw.mods.modlauncher.TransformingClassLoader$DelegatedClassLoader.findClass(TransformingClassLoader.java:282) ~[modlauncher-8.1.3.jar:?]
		at cpw.mods.modlauncher.TransformingClassLoader.loadClass(TransformingClassLoader.java:136) ~[modlauncher-8.1.3.jar:?]
		at cpw.mods.modlauncher.TransformingClassLoader.loadClass(TransformingClassLoader.java:98) ~[modlauncher-8.1.3.jar:?]
		at java.lang.ClassLoader.loadClass(ClassLoader.java:519) ~[?:?]
		at hellfirepvp.astralsorcery.common.integration.IntegrationJEI.registerRecipeTransferHandlers(IntegrationJEI.java:128) ~[astralsorcery:1.16.4-1.14.1]
		at me.shedaniel.rei.jeicompat.JEIPluginDetector$JEIPluginWrapper.registerTransferHandlers(JEIPluginDetector.java:511) ~[roughlyenoughitems:?]
		at me.shedaniel.rei.impl.client.transfer.TransferHandlerRegistryImpl.acceptPlugin(TransferHandlerRegistryImpl.java:43) ~[roughlyenoughitems:?]
		at me.shedaniel.rei.impl.client.transfer.TransferHandlerRegistryImpl.acceptPlugin(TransferHandlerRegistryImpl.java:37) ~[roughlyenoughitems:?]
		at me.shedaniel.rei.api.common.registry.Reloadable.acceptPlugin(Reloadable.java:72) ~[roughlyenoughitems:?]
		at me.shedaniel.rei.impl.common.plugins.PluginManagerImpl.lambda$startReload$8(PluginManagerImpl.java:300) ~[roughlyenoughitems:?]
		at me.shedaniel.rei.impl.common.plugins.PluginManagerImpl.pluginSection(PluginManagerImpl.java:180) ~[roughlyenoughitems:?]
		at me.shedaniel.rei.impl.common.plugins.PluginManagerImpl.startReload(PluginManagerImpl.java:289) ~[roughlyenoughitems:?]
		at me.shedaniel.rei.RoughlyEnoughItemsCore._reloadPlugins(RoughlyEnoughItemsCore.java:141) ~[roughlyenoughitems:?]
		at me.shedaniel.rei.RoughlyEnoughItemsCore._reloadPlugins(RoughlyEnoughItemsCore.java:132) ~[roughlyenoughitems:?]
		at me.shedaniel.rei.RoughlyEnoughItemsCoreClient.lambda$reloadPlugins$22(RoughlyEnoughItemsCoreClient.java:436) ~[roughlyenoughitems:?]
		at java.util.concurrent.CompletableFuture$AsyncRun.run(CompletableFuture.java:1800) [?:?]
		at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:515) [?:?]
		at java.util.concurrent.FutureTask.run(FutureTask.java:264) [?:?]
		at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:304) [?:?]
		at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1130) [?:?]
		at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:630) [?:?]
		at java.lang.Thread.run(Thread.java:831) [?:?]